HC Deb 20 April 1988 vol 131 cc458-9W
Ms. Richardson

To ask the Secretary of State for Foreign and Commonwealth Affairs what child care provision his Department provides for pre-school age children of the Department's employees; what child care provision for school holiday and/or after school care is provided for employees' children aged five and over; what plans there are for increasing provision in the next five years; and how these are to be funded.

Mrs. Chalker

The Foreign and Commonwealth Office has no child care provision at present, either for the preschool age group or for those aged five and over.

There is a proposal to provide child care facilities for the pre-school age group and/or a holiday play scheme. Both would be user-funded.
